2017 marks the third annual New Jersey Makers Day
(Somerset County, NJ: March 1, 2017) To celebrate making and maker culture, residents throughout New Jersey will come together on Friday, March 24 and Saturday, March 25 in libraries, schools, museums, colleges, makerspaces, businesses and other community locations for the third annual New Jersey Makers Day. NJ Makers Day is designed to be a statewide event that celebrates, promotes, and in many cases may introduce maker culture, as well as the values associated with making, tinkering and STEM-based learning. In 2016, NJ Makers Day drew over 40,000 individual attendees to more than 230 participating sites across all 21 counties in the state. Participating locations included public and academic libraries, schools, museums, commercial makerspaces, and AC Moore stores, as well as sponsorship from such organizations as LibraryLinkNJ, littleBits Electronics, and ManufactureNJ. This year, Somerset County Library System of New Jersey’s 10 library branches will have a wide variety of New Jersey Makers Day programs for the community to enjoy.
